Commit d2a9745
committed
refactor(search): unified overlay to document.body for all modes
- Overlay now ALWAYS uses imperative DOM in document.body
- Removed Lit render() overlay logic for simplicity and reliability
- All styles are inline to avoid shadow DOM CSS scoping issues
- Lit render() only produces the trigger button
- Mobile Safari compatibility improved1 parent ffc3070 commit d2a9745
1 file changed
Lines changed: 165 additions & 223 deletions
0 commit comments